Karnali govt collects Rs 21.47 million in tourism revenue last fiscal year



KARNALI: The Karnali Province government collected Rs 21.475 million in revenue from various tourism destinations within the province during the last fiscal year 2023/24.

The revenue breakdown includes Rs 4.112 million from Rara National Park, Rs 9.090 million from Surkhet Provincial Martyrs Park, Rs 1.150 million from Kakrebihar, and Rs 7.114 million from Bulbule Park.

Dev Kumari Shahi, Chief Administrative Officer of the Tourism Development Section under the Industry, Tourism, Forests, and Environment Ministry, noted that revenue from Shey Phoksundo Lake, Dailekh View Tower at Guranse Rural Municipality, and several other sites has not been included in this total.

The Ministry does not have records of revenue collected from Kupinde Lake in Salyan, Syarpu Pond in Rukum East, Gidi Pond, Chandannath Temple, and Kanakasundari in Jumla, Tripurasundari in Dolpa, Pachal Waterfall in Kalikot, Panchakoshi, Dullu Palace, Gadhi area of Dailekh, Limi Valley in Humla, Jajarkot Palace, Baraha Pond, and Jajura Pond in Surkhet.
